Transaction 6953f8e96713db71644a08991a0c0cf1b1c18f4116fe0cf23f775b545663b8e7

3 Input
2 Outputs
  • 6953f8e96713db71644a08991a0c0cf1b1c18f4116fe0cf23f775b545663b8e7:0
  • value  347381993
    address  12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v
  • 6953f8e96713db71644a08991a0c0cf1b1c18f4116fe0cf23f775b545663b8e7:1
  • value  24354854
    address  12gcXT4fm2PfGPN7T8vntoRDVESLsGsRKG